Magnesium fires are classified as Class D fires, which involve combustible metals that can burn at extremely high temperatures. For these types of fires, the appropriate fire extinguisher is a Class D extinguisher, specifically designed to control fires involving flammable metal substances like magnesium. Class D extinguishers often use specific dry powders, such as sodium chloride or copper powder, that work by smothering the fire without reacting with the burning metal.

Using water-based extinguishers or AFFF-type extinguishers is not suitable for magnesium fires because these can react violently with burning magnesium, potentially worsening the situation by spreading the fire or causing an explosion. CO2 extinguishers are ineffective since they are typically used for flammable liquids and electrical fires and do not address the unique challenges posed by metal fires.
